What i don't like is the instructions, they seem written for someone who is familiar with the product not some old guy like me. The biggest oversight in the instructions is the CO2 cartridge is punctured when the sleeve that holds it is screwed no by twisting QUICKLY onto the cap. This is why the cap must be in the closed position. I wasted a cartridge by going slow and I stopped when the gas was released. Had I twisted the sleeve tighter fast it would not have been a problem. Next be aware that if you leave the gas to the open position as you pour your glass you may get 2/3rds foam to 1/3rd beer. I manage the gas as I pour my beer by opening and closing the gas knob as I pour. But who the hell cares?
